WebFeb 1, 2024 · Although support for progressive images is widespread among the most popular browsers, it is not universal. When progressive JPEGs are received by browsers that do not support them (such as versions of Internet Explorer before Windows 7) the software displays the image only after it has been completely downloaded. WebJPEG XL offers significantly better image quality and compression ratio compared to legacy JPEG. Through lossless JPEG recompression, it is possible to convert JPEGs from the past to the new format quickly. JPEG XL supports both lossless and lossy compression. Lossless compression reduces filesizes by 20-60%.
